# Tilepress Prefetcher — Limits and Quotas

The prefetcher warms tiles around a user's viewport before pan events. It is deliberately conservative: the upstream Cartavale tile farm rate-limits us per region, and blowing the quota degrades live requests, not just prefetch. Prefetch is disabled entirely on metered connections and below zoom 8. Queue overflow drops the oldest requests silently — that's intentional, don't "fix" it. All quotas are enforced client-side using the constants defined directly below this paragraph.

limits module of kahag-fajop:
QUOTAS = {
    "wenwyn": 10,
    "zorath": 1,
}

**Document Transport: Sealed Exam Papers — Thornbury Hall**

Sealed exam papers for the Ashgrove Proficiency Exam are delivered by Larkfield Secure Transit the day before each sitting. Receiving staff verify seal integrity, log arrival time, and move the consignment directly to the strongroom. Papers stay sealed until the chief invigilator opens them in the exam hall. The courier hand-over must follow the confidential instruction below.

handover note for yagef-bagep: the drudor pelius courier leaves the kasdor zorvan norir ledger at gate 8016 under passcode 755406

Quarterly Planning Note — Divestiture of the Coastal Tooling Unit

For the finance team: the sale of the Coastal Tooling unit to Pellmark Industries remains on track for close in Q3. Please finalize the carve-out balance sheet, reconcile intercompany positions, and prepare the working-capital adjustment schedule by month-end. Audit support requests should be prioritized. For planning purposes, note the following sensitive item:

internal memo for hawef-kahif: The finance team signed off on a budget of $25.9 million for Project Sorox. The renewal with Pelokek Logistics closes at $51.7 million a year, 52 percent below the last contract.

## Configuration

The Oxbow ORM shim reads settings from `.env` during the migration period. Keep `ORM_COMPAT_MODE=legacy` until every repository class is ported; flipping it early breaks lazy-loading in the billing module. Connection pool sizing follows the old defaults deliberately — do not "optimize" it mid-refactor. The database credential string must appear on the next line.

sealed setting: VAULT_KEY20=69e2a0b23f1a79fbf692